About Blog Article
A blog article is a long-form written piece published on a website, designed to inform, educate, or engage a specific audience with structured, in-depth content.
Typically 800–2,500 words with clear headings, an introduction, structured body sections, and a conclusion.
About Newsletter
A newsletter is a regularly distributed email update sent to a subscribed audience, designed to inform, entertain, or drive action as part of an ongoing reader relationship.
Structured with a subject line, short intro, one or more body sections, and a closing call to action; typically 300–600 words.
Tips for best results
- Add a personal intro sentence connecting the article to something current or relevant to your specific subscribers
- Break the article into 2–3 clear newsletter sections with short headers for inbox readability
- Close with a CTA linking back to the full post for readers who want more depth
